"Khanom jeen is a dish that’s synonymous with Phuket. Everybody eats these fresh rice noodles topped with different curries, sauces, and herbs for breakfast. This spot near Saphan Park is one of the few places where you can eat khanom jeen for lunch or early dinner. The curries and sauces they have change often, but the ones with peanut and beef are particularly good—the peanut sauce is super savory, and a nice balance to the chili oil, anchovies, and thai basil you should top it with. The noodles themselves are particularly bouncy, and an individual serving only costs around $2.
